Composition: a product based on environmentally friendly wood.

The core of laminate flooring and a 'panel consisting of high-density' fibreboard (HDF). HDF panels are formed for 90% of wood fibers and the remaining 10% from bio-compatible resin. The surface layer of HDF and 'generally consists of several layers of paper with high quality' impregnated with a melamine resin transparent. The bottom has a background. The laminate floors are therefore formed by the fibers of the renewable raw material in wood with a small quantity 'of synthetic resin. They are made of modern production facilities that meet the current standards in terms of respect emissions and measures environmental protection. Many plants possess also produce their own energy and heat. The positive performance data about the life cycle of products based on wood and then apply in principle for laminate flooring. The melamine resin used for impregnating the paper sheet surface and 'water-based, that does not contain organic solvents and, when galvanized, surface forms a highly resistant to chemicals, water, organic solvents, to light and temperature. The patterns are printed with inks using modern technology and pigments that are not harmful to health. The surface layer of the panels contains a natural substance based mineral (corundum), which provides extra protection against wear. The background panel can 'be provided, upon request, a coating noise. All COMPON bodies laminate flooring are produced without the addition of pesticides, organic-chlorinated compounds and heavy metals harmful, also the surface layers do not contain any plasticizer agent. The laminate flooring products are durable and resistant to wear, they can be easily replaced and repaired thanks to connections without glue commonly used today. These floor you may be disposed of as unsorted waste without any problem as for recycling material and heat. Therefore, the floors are not removed wastes and their disposal is more 'economical.

Emissions: odorless and very low emission of hazardous substances.


laminate floors are free of smell and emissions are very low. This' is due to both their composition and their production process. Sudi recent showed that the level of emissions of organic matter from this type of flooring and 'negligible. This is a result not surprising given that the production process does not involve the use of any organic solvent. There can be occasional traces of volatile compounds contained in wood, which tend to disappear quickly. The material background of laminate flooring also produces weak emission and, if properly installed, has no impact on the quality of 'indoor air. Another well-known pollutant and 'formaldehyde. Despite this substance present in the melamine resin, and it 'fixed irreversibly by vulcanization in the structure of the resin. The formaldehyde emissions from laminate floors are so far below the legal limit. Numerous measurements on modern laminate flooring reveal values \u200b\u200bof formaldehyde emissions comparable to those of wood in nature. laminate floors, therefore, have a zero or negligible impact in terms of indoor air pollution through smells or harmful substances. The floors are laid out, then, do not absorb any of these substances.

Hygiene: easy to clean and suitable for allergy sufferers.

laminate floors are made - as before - without pesticides, compounds organo-chlorinated and harmful heavy metals. There is therefore no possibility 'that end users come in contact with these harmful substances. These floors are very easy to take clean. Dirt and dust can be removed completely from the smooth surface of laminates by brushing, steam cleaning or keeping the floor dry completely clean and in perfect hygienic conditions. addition, non-porous surface layer is an unfavorable environment for the development and proliferation of dust mite allergens and other micro-organisms. This feature, combined with the ease 'of cleaning, thereby making them particularly suitable for floors allergy sufferers.

Laying techniques.

The track system mainly depends on the thickness and size of the laminate. If the thickness and 'greater than 14 to 16 mm. the width of more than 80 to 90 mm. and length beyond 1000. often prefer to use the floating installation, but if the dimensions are reduced and the stratification and 'type two-layer (support base plate and a layer of solid wood) and' more 'that the recommended installation in place through the use of adhesive. Finally, as regards the specific indications for the background, environment and operational conditions of installation, they are completely identical to those for all other different types of wood elements by laying parquet, namely:
  • screed aged. of adequate thickness, that resonates in full, with a vapor barrier inserted into the thick, moisture-free 'residual greater than 1.5 to 2% and the surface layer that does not create dust or grain.
  • environmental humidity conditions' on air between 45 and 65% and temperature between 16 and 21 ° C.
